1.2 Beagle Characteristics: Identifying Typical Traits

Beagles are small to medium-sized dogs with a distinctive appearance. They typically have a well-proportioned body, a square muzzle, and long, floppy ears. Their coat is usually a combination of white, black, and tan. Beagles are scent hounds, originally bred for hunting rabbits and other small game. This heritage gives them a strong sense of smell and a natural curiosity about their surroundings.

Common Beagle Traits:

Trait Description
Size Small to medium
Build Sturdy and muscular
Coat Usually tricolor (white, black, and tan)
Ears Long and floppy
Temperament Friendly, curious, and energetic
Hunting Instinct Strong sense of smell, bred for hunting

1.4 The Influence of Charles Schulz’s Childhood Dog

Charles Schulz’s childhood dog, Spike, was a significant inspiration for Snoopy’s character. Schulz described Spike as a smart, mixed-breed dog who understood many words. This intelligence and cleverness found its way into Snoopy’s personality, making him more than just a typical cartoon beagle.

4.1 Charles Schulz: The Man Behind the Peanuts Gang

Charles Schulz was born in Minneapolis, Minnesota, in 1922. He showed an early talent for drawing and dreamed of becoming a cartoonist. After serving in World War II, he began his career as a comic strip artist, eventually creating the Peanuts comic strip in 1950.

Key Facts:

  • Born in Minneapolis, Minnesota, in 1922
  • Served in World War II
  • Created the Peanuts comic strip in 1950
  • Died in 2000, shortly before his final strip was published

5. Snoopy’s Siblings: Exploring the Beagle Family Tree

Snoopy’s family tree is surprisingly extensive, with several siblings who have made appearances in the Peanuts comic strip. This section introduces Snoopy’s siblings, explores their individual personalities, and discusses their relationships with Snoopy.

5.1 Introducing Snoopy’s Siblings: A Cast of Colorful Characters

Snoopy has several siblings who have appeared in the Peanuts comic strip over the years. These include:

  • Spike: Snoopy’s brother, known for his adventurous spirit and love of the desert.
  • Belle: Snoopy’s sister, known for her beauty and grace.
  • Marbles: Snoopy’s brother, known for his absent-mindedness and quirky personality.
  • Olaf: Snoopy’s brother, known for his unconventional looks and good humor.
  • Andy: Another of Snoopy’s brothers, who made appearances later in the comic strip’s run.

5.5 Olaf: The Unconventional Brother with a Good Sense of Humor

Olaf is Snoopy’s brother who is known for his unconventional looks and good sense of humor. He won an “Ugly Dog” contest, which he took in stride with his positive attitude.
